Giving this a 10 for the miniseries itself - I truly enjoyed it. The acting was superb BBC quality all the way. The romances are a nice mixture of what we love about a good romance - two people who genuinely care about each other, but not shallow and immature. Another great Dickens commentary on Victorian era snobbery and inequality, along with the reality that good and bad exists on both sides of the economic divide. Ten for the quality of the story and production.
